The ingredients needed to make Seafood Mac and Cheese:
  1. Make ready 7 1/4 oz macaroni and cheese dinner kit
  2. Get 2 eggs lightly beaten
  3. Make ready 8 oz Alfredo sauce
  4. Prepare 3/4 lb imitation crab meat
  5. Prepare 2 cups shredded queso cheese

Steps to make Seafood Mac and Cheese:
  1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ees
  2. Prepare mac and cheese according to directions. Add in eggs
  3. Spread in greased 9 x 13 pan
  4. Top with sauce, crab and cheese.
  5. Bake uncovered for 30 - 35 minutes until cheese is golden and melted
